
App4SHM - Bridge Structural Health Monitoring
Project coordinated by Elói Figueiredo, Director of the Civil Engineering Degree at ULusófona.
07.11.23 - 10h58The Civil Research Group of Universidade Lusófona - Centro Universitário Lisboa, developed an application with the purpose of monitoring the structural health (Structural Health Monitoring - SHM) of bridges or other civil structures, with the aim of evaluating the condition after a extreme event or when requested by authorities.
The project involved the participation of students and teachers from the University's Civil Engineering and Computer Engineering courses, with Elói Figueiredo, Director of the Degree in Civil Engineering at ULusófona, as coordinator.
App4SHM is now available for download via the Apple Store and Google Play!
